Description
Pen-isa'r-Glascoed Outbuilding is a structure made of local axe-dressed uncoursed limestone, oriented north to south. It features a stepped gable at the south end and a gable chimney at the north end, topped with corrugated steel roof sheeting. The eastern elevation has three brick arches above two cartsheds and a possible tackroom or groom's lodge. There are loft hatches above the arches; two of these are walled up, while one has been converted into a window. To the south, there is a low building with a slate roof and a painted brick front wall.
